<p>The first stop of the Winter Dew Tour wrapped up Sunday in Breckinridge, Co., and six athletes are each $15,000 richer.</p>
<p>It&#8217;s a record setting event&#8212;the first winter tour for the huge Dew/<a href="http://www.allisports.com/" target="_blank">Alli</a> empire, the first exhibition for women freeskiers, and unlike the one-week, one-stop X Games, there are three stops in the Winter Dew, where repeat winners can total up huge prizes  to rival the heavy money X Games. In addition, women winners in snowboard pipe and slopestyle will get paid the same as the men.</p>
<p>Shaun White got his loot for winning Saturday&#8217;s snowboard slopestyle contest, while nearly unknown Canadian rider Spencer O’Brien had the run of her life and ruled women’s snowboard slopestyle, scoring seven points higher than her closest competition.</p>
<p>But gasps of awe and screams of joy went to Breck local Bobby Brown, who won freeski slopestyle with ever bigger tricks as he rode his run, most of them switch, including a switch misty 1080&#8212;upside down and twisting&#8212;to a switch double rodeo 900 from the top of one jump, and spinning like a gyroscope off the others.</p>
<p>The show continued Saturday night under bright lights, when freeskier Tanner Hall shook off all the rest to land the first 1080 of his career&#8212;at the bottom of the superpipe. He went on with back to back nines, and tricked all the way to the bottom.</p>
<p>While there are lots of women who go big on boards, there are not yet enough women freeskiers who throw down well enough to contest for the best at the Winter Dew, so while there are women freeskiing pipe and slopestyle exhibitions, they&#8217;re not yet part of the official contests.</p>
<p>Sunday&#8217;s finals were bluebird all the way, after a week of qualifying and contests where the snow never stopped. &#8220;Today was the first day it didn&#8217;t snow, but we still had great competitions the whole time. In the open qualifiers, there were close to 250 athletes,&#8221; said Chris Prybylo, the Dew&#8217;s Vice President of Events.</p>
<p>The wrap up was total pipe, and Gretchen Bleiler continued her domination, with halfpipe amplitude rarely seen in women riders. Danny Davis won superpipe.<br />
<span id="more-2522"></span><br />
Prybylo said, &#8220;We didn&#8217;t have any double winners; nobody won more than one event. Shaun White won slopestyle and finished second in superpipe. I think everyone competed really well every day.&#8221;</p>
<p>He went on to rave about newcomer Bobby Brown. &#8220;He&#8217;s only 17, and I think he&#8217;s going to be a great athlete. He had an incredible run Saturday. All of these guys are competing for the Dew Cup. No one has the most points yet because it&#8217;s the first event. They are also competing for an overall bonus purse that will be awarded at the finals.&#8221;</p>
<p>When Prybylo was asked if hearty partying was underway, he hedged a bit, then diplomatically said, &#8220;they were in a contest, they wrapped it up. I think everyone&#8217;s going to enjoy themselves tonight.&#8221;</p>
<p>The Winter Dew Tour stops next at Mt. Snow Resort in Dover, Vt. on Jan. 8-11, then to the season finals at Northstar-at-Tahoe in Lake Tahoe, Ca., on Feb. 19-22. Each stop will have the Dew&#8217;s signature &#8220;Village,&#8221; concerts, bands and dancing in the streets.</p>

<p>Here are the podium results of all the events:</p>
<p><strong>Men’s Snowboard Slopestyle Finals</strong><br />
1. Shaun White, Carlsbad, Calif. 95.17.<br />
2. Mikkel Bang, Norway, 92.33.<br />
3. Janne Korpi, Finland, 86.17.</p>
<p><strong>Women’s Snowboard Slopestyle Finals</strong><br />
1. Spencer O’Brien, Canada, 85.00.<br />
2. Jenny Jones, Great Britain, 77.33.<br />
3. Bev Vuilleumier, South Lake Tahoe, Calif., 74.17.</p>
<p><strong>Men’s Freeski Slopestyle Finals</strong><br />
1. Bobby Brown, Breckenridge, Colo., 90.50.<br />
2. Josiah Wells, New Zealand, 89.50.<br />
3. Henrik Harlaut, Sweden, 85.67.</p>
<p><strong>Men’s Freeski Superpipe Finals</strong><br />
1. Tanner Hall, Kalispell, Mont., 90.75.<br />
2. Justin Dorey, Canada, 85.50.<br />
3. Duncan Adams, Breckenridge, Colo., 81.00.</p>
<p><strong>Men&#8217;s Snowboard Superpipe Finals</strong><br />
1. Danny Davis &#8211; 94.75<br />
2. Shaun White &#8211; 93.50<br />
3. Scotty Lago &#8211; 90.00</p>
<p><strong>Women&#8217;s Snowboard Superpipe Finals</strong><br />
1. Gretchen Bleiler &#8211; 90.25<br />
2. Kelly Clark &#8211; 86.75<br />
3. Elena Hight &#8211; 82.00</p>

<p>In conjunction with Oakley’ Week, <a target="_blank" href="http://www.fuel.tv" title="fuel">Fuel TV’s </a>“The Daily Habit” will look a bit different for a few days as they will temporarily relocate to downtown Breckenridge and Copper Mountain, Colorado.  This will be the first time the hit show will not be shot in Los Angeles, rather in front of a real mountain backdrop. </p>
<p>Look for Oakley&#8217;s world class snowboarders including Olympic gold medalist, “The Flying Tomato” Shaun White, National Geographic Adventure&#8217;s &#8220;Adventurer of the Year&#8221; Gretchen Bleiler, two-time Olympic silver medalist Danny Kass, seven time X Games gold medalist Tanner Hall and many more to be featured in one-on-one interviews on Breckenridge&#8217;s Blue River Plaza, as well as on-hill shred sessions at Copper Mountain.</p>
<p>&#8220;FUEL TV is really excited about our upcoming partnership with Oakley,&#8221; says Scott Paridon, FUEL TV VP of Production and Development. &#8220;We look forward to featuring its world class athletes on &#8216;The Daily Habit&#8217; in a completely new location. These shows will take FUEL TV to a whole new level and provide viewers with a fun and unique experience.&#8221;</p>

<p>With the long, extensive, and hectic Summer Dew Tour just behind us, the athletes in winter clothing are gearing up for the 2008 Winter Dew Tour set to kick off on December 18th in Breckenridge, Colorado.  Announced today were some of the world’s best snowboarders and freestyle skiers who will be competing for the Dew Cup and a piece of that $1.5 million prize purse waiting for them at the end of the three-stop series. </p>
<p>The all star roster reads like the who’s who of the modern freeski and snowboard movement, highlighted by multiple X Games and Olympic medalists including snowboard athletes Shaun White, Hannah Teter, Andreas Wiig, Travis Rice and Gretchen Bleiler. Freeskiing superstars Tanner Hall, Sarah Burke and Simon Dumont will join the snowboarders on the impressive roster of athletes.</p>
<p>&#8220;I&#8217;m thrilled for the start of the Winter Dew Tour this December,&#8221; said Dumont. &#8220;This is just what we need to give skiing the exposure it deserves. We&#8217;ll have live TV coverage and the resorts chosen are some of the best in the world.&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8220;I feel like the Dew Tour is gonna be huge and I&#8217;m really looking forward to riding on the entire series this year,&#8221; said Teter. &#8220;The roster of athletes that will be competing on the Winter Dew Tour is sick. It&#8217;ll be a fun battle to see who comes away with Dew Cup at the end of the season.&#8221;</p>

Similar to the Dew Tour’s summer competition structure, the Winter Dew Tour will be based on a cumulative points system as the top snow athletes battle it out for a piece of the $1.5 million prize purse and the chance to take home the Dew Cup at the conclusion of the season in February.<br />
 <br />
The complete 2008/09 Winter Dew Tour schedule is as follows:<br />
 <br />
Event                           Date                             Location<br />
Stop 1                          Dec. 18-21, 2008           Breckenridge, Colo.—Breckenridge Ski Resort<br />
Stop 2                          Jan. 8-11, 2009              West Dover, Vt.—Mount Snow Resort<br />
Stop 3                          Feb. 19-22, 2009           Lake Tahoe, Calif.—Northstar-at-Tahoe Resort<br />
